Output 0624da51e73c0a87a4827bbf6cf24dc46ae531a17c9250583662b9b961e84109:0

value
15958211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45646b683ab16aef8c6bc29472eb646caaa4e81d OP_EQUAL
address
381vr43hZ4v7WQ6nSaSQSSKWtbTNTgQGDp
transaction
0624da51e73c0a87a4827bbf6cf24dc46ae531a17c9250583662b9b961e84109
spent
true